Art al Fresco returns to Bristol

Posted

Come down to The Bristol Art Museum for Art al Fresco, BAM's annual Art Fair & Sale featuring the works of select Artist Members. Enjoy the fabulous display of artwork in all mediums on the lawn and along the fence of Linden Place, as well as the adjacent Bradford-Dimond House fence on Hope Street. Browse your local arts scene and bring home a treasure, or simply enjoy the sights of our tree shaded art stroll in Bristol’s beautiful and historic downtown.
 
WHERE: Hope St., Bristol, between Wardwell and State Streets
WHEN: Saturday, Sept. 14; 9 a.m. to 2 p.m.
COST: Free
